Weather in July

July experiences the highest levels of rainfall and humidity in Batangafo, making it the wettest month of the year. Despite the dampness, the weather remains fairly warm. Rainfall surges to a staggering 117mm (4.61") which is the most precipitation in any given month. There are also fewer sunlight hours with the city only absorbing six hours of sunshine per day. Wind speeds continue their downward trend from the previous month.

Temperature

The advent of July denotes an average high-temperature of a moderately hot 29.4°C (84.9°F), subtly different from June's 32.2°C (90°F). Batangafo reports an average nighttime low-temperature of 20.3°C (68.5°F) in July.

Heat index

The average heat index in July is calculated to be a torrid 36°C (96.8°F). Take greater precautions, heat exhaustion and heat cramps may be expected. Heatstroke could result from lengthy activity.
Heat index guidelines indicate values are for light wind scenarios and shaded regions. The heat index might be elevated by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ees due to direct sun exposure.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'feels like' or 'apparent temperature', is a value derived by merging air temperature with the humidity to convey how the climate feels. One's perception of temperature is subjective, varying based on their activity and individual heat perception, influenced by factors like wind, clothing, and metabolic variations. Be mindful that being in direct sunlight might mean feeling hotter, with the heat index rising by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values remain especially vital for babies and toddlers. Youngsters frequently overlook the need for breaks and fluid intake. Thirst is an advanced sign of dehydration - thereby highlighting the importance of keeping hydrated, particularly during long physical activities.
To cool down, the human body relies on perspiration, a process where excessive heat is eliminated as sweat evaporates. Increased relative humidity interferes with body cooling by slowing the rate of evaporation, resulting in a slower body cooling rate and a heightened feeling of heat. As body temperatures escalate without effective heat release, one might face dehydration threats.

Humidity

In July, the average relative humidity is 82%.

Rainfall

In July, in Batangafo, the rain falls for 23.2 days. Throughout July, 117mm (4.61") of precipitation is accumulated. In Batangafo, during the entire year, the rain falls for 149.7 days and collects up to 622mm (24.49") of precipitation.

Daylight

The average length of the day in July is 12h and 30min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 05:34 and sunset at 18:07. On the last day of July, in Batangafo, sunrise is at 05:40 and sunset at 18:06 WAT.

Sunshine

In Batangafo, the average sunshine in July is 9.6h.

UV index

June through September, with an average maximum UV index of 6, are months with the lowest UV index in Batangafo. A UV Index estimate of 6 to 7 represents a high health vulnerability from exposure to the Sun's UV rays for the average person.
